High Dose Steroids in Children With Stroke
NCT04873583 · Status: RECRUITING · Phase: PHASE3 · Type: INTERVENTIONAL · Enrollment: 70
Last updated 2025-11-18
Summary
This clinical trial deals with focal cerebral arteriopathy and childhood stroke, a rare but devastating condition.
Focal cerebral arteriopathy (FCA) is an inflammatory vessel wall disease provoked by infection and there is increasing evidence that inflammatory processes play a crucial role in childhood stroke, influencing the outcome of the disease.
Analysis of existing data suggests that outcomes are improved and that there is less stroke recurrence in children treated with steroids to reduce the acute inflammatory processes. This clinical trial will be conducted in over 20 hospitals in several countries in order to investigate this.
Participants will be randomly separated into two groups. The first group will be treated with standard of care (including aspirin) combined with high dose steroids. The second group will be treated with standard of care (including aspirin) but without steroid treatment.
The objective is to investigate if children treated with a combination of high dose steroid and aspirin will have a better and quicker recovery of FCA, better clinical functional outcome, and less recurrence compared to children treated with aspirin alone.
This project has been identified by international pediatric stroke experts as the most important topic for a clinical trial in the field and is as well one of the most important research priorities identified by parents. The study results will also provide insight into the evolution of inflammatory vessel disease.

Interventions
- DRUG
-
Methylprednisolone
At the time of inclusion, intravenous Methylprednisolone for 3 days. Dose: 30 mg/kg/day (max. 1000 mg/dose)
- DRUG
-
Prednisolone
Intravenous treatment will be immediately followed by oral tapering with Prednisolone. Oral Prednisolone, 2 weeks (week 1 and 2) Dose: 1 mg/kg/day (max 40 mg/day) Oral Prednisolone, 2 weeks (week 3 and 4) Dose: 0.5 mg/kg/day (max 20 mg/day)
